Check out the companies making headlines in midday trading. Affirm — Affirm shares jumped 17% a day after the fintech company reported fiscal first-quarter revenue that topped expectations. Affirm posted $496.5 million in revenue, more than the $444.5 million consensus estimate, according to FactSet. Virgin Galactic Holdings — Shares rallied more than 20% a day after the company announced its cost-savings initiative , which includes pausing spaceflight operations next year.

Arm Holdings — Arm shares dropped 6% in midday trading. On Wednesday, the semiconductor technology company said that fiscal third-quarter adjusted earnings would range between 21 cents and 28 cents per share, while analysts polled by FactSet called for 27 cents per share.
